Reflection

This phrase comes as a quiet reminder: in the hardest moments, it is important not to become yet another strict judge for yourself. You can be there for yourself not only when everything works out, but also when you make mistakes, grow tired, and doubt yourself. To lift yourself up does not mean being made of iron and never falling. It means reaching out to yourself instead of hurting yourself with inner words.

Sometimes a person wounds themselves more deeply than circumstances do: with reproaches, comparisons, and impossible expectations. And then it is as if an enemy appears inside, one that does not let you catch your breath and keeps demanding more. This card gently invites you to choose another side — not to attack yourself, but to support yourself. To be your own friend means speaking to yourself the way you would speak to someone you truly love.

Perhaps today you especially need to hear that you do not have to earn a kind attitude toward yourself. It is needed by you already now, in the state you are in. Even if the day is heavy, even if there is little strength, even if much remains unclear. A small kind decision in your own favor can become the very step from which inner relief begins.

The meaning of this phrase is not that you must carry everything alone and ask no one for help. Rather, it is about having at least one warm voice inside you that does not abandon you. When you choose to be your own friend, you stop fighting with yourself and begin to return to your living self. And in this choice there is much quiet strength — not loud, not showy, but real.
